Transaction 8034536087669fca9a5eec7b8297e0a686e0824a39a79112c4019b1b613dd4bc
1 Input
1 Output
-
8034536087669fca9a5eec7b8297e0a686e0824a39a79112c4019b1b613dd4bc:0
- value
- 5011332
- script pubkey
- OP_0 OP_PUSHBYTES_20 587095e18e31b183a7b567a08e1f000aa23e138a
- address
- bc1qtpcftcvwxxcc8fa4v7sgu8cqp23ruyu286fclt